title disambig
Game | Date | SW Name |
---|---|---|
Dogz (1995) | 1995 | |
Catz (1995) | 1995 | |
Dogz 2 | 1997 | |
Dogz 3 | 9/28/1998 | |
Catz 3 | 9/28/1998 | |
Dogz 4 | 9/28/1999 | |
Catz 4 | 9/28/1999 | |
Virtual Petz: Catz II & Dogz II | 11/30/1999 | |
Dogz 5 | 11/18/2002 | |
Catz 5 | 11/18/2002 | |
Petz: Dogz 5 & Catz 5 Compilation | 1/15/2005 | |
Dogz: Happy House | 4/27/2006 | |
Dogz | 11/14/2006 | |
Catz | 11/30/2006 | |
Dogz 2008 (Europe) / Petz: Dogz 2 (US) | 10/12/2007 | |
Catz 2 (Europe) / Petz: Catz 2 (US) | 11/09/2007 | |
Hamsterz 2 (Europe) / Petz: Hamsterz 2 (US) | 11/09/2007 | |
Petz Wild Animals: Dolphinz | 10/16/2007 | |
Petz: Hamsterz Life 2 | 11/13/2007 | |
Petz: Horsez 2 | 11/14/2007 | |
Petz Wild Animals: Tigerz | 2/26/2008 | |
Petz Bunnyz | 3/4/2008 | |
Petz Vet | 3/20/07 | |
Petz Dogz Fasion | 6/17/2008 | |
Petz Rescue Wildlife Vet | 10/21/2008 | |
Petz Rescue Ocean Patrol | 10/28/2008 | |
Petz Dogz Pack | 11/04/2008 | |
Petz Sports: Dog Playground | 11/04/2008 | |
Petz: Horsez Club | 11/11/2008 | |
Petz Catz Clan | 11/18/2008 | |
Petz Rescue Endangered Paradise | 11/18/2008 | |
Petz Monkeyz House | 11/18/2008 | |
Petz Crazy Monkeyz | 11/18/2008 | |
Petz: My Puppy Family | 11/26/2008 | |
Petz Horseshoe Ranch | 1/27/2009 | |
Petz: My Kitten Family | 2/13/2009 | |
Petz: My Monkey Family | 2/13/2009 | |
Petz: Monkey Madness | 2/13/2009 | |
Petz: Saddle Club | 2/17/2009 |
